[Albion] Player ratings vs Spurs (h)

What an absolutely bonkers game of football. Utterly thrilling.
Some stunning performances in there from a fair few players. Shame about the loss of control at the end. Ditto with Dunk's booking, meaning RDZ is going to have to weave some different magic against in-form West Ham, especially as it looks as though Igor and Buonanotte have picked up injuries. From no wide players, to just one CB.

Steele 7.5 -- some stunning distribution there, not sure he had a save to make
Hinshelwood 8 -- what a mature performance, so good, a brilliant finish, and some great play. Snuffed Son out, but looked less assured against Gil.
JPvH 8 -- a rock
Dunk 8 -- got in the way of everything, unfortunately over-committed for their first goal, and picked up a yellow when four up
Igor 7 -- a few dicey moments, but hope the injury doesn't keep him out too long
Gilmour 9 -- brilliant performance, he's in such a rich vein of form, dictates things and becoming more physical
Gross 8.5 -- so good yet again, but no assists: what's up Pascal?
Milner 9 -- amazing performance, RDZ loves him for his attitude; tonight we should love him for his quality
Welbeck 8.5 -- ran them ragged, was top quality tonight
Buonanotte 7 -- some things paid off, others didn't
Joao Pedro 9 MotM -- two goals, an assist, and stretched their high line and made them pay. Sent their keeper the wrong way twice: again. What a player he is.

Pervis 8 -- welcome back; I like the way he didn't push things tonight. And what a strike
Ferguson 6
Moder 5 -- thought he was poor tonight, passing not up to much, and didn't capitalise on some good opportunities. Some good tackling and physicality. He'll come good.
Baleba 6
Lallana n/a

Not much to debate there except Dunk I thought was a 7. A couple of over ambitious passes in the first half and distinctly dodgy last 20 mins. Dwelt on the ball too long for their first goal and on another day could have got a red as opposed to a yellow and the suspension. Personally I also thought he was a little asleep at the back post for their second. At the kick off it also looked like Gross had a few stern words with him which which I would speculate might have been along the lines of ' come on focus ' !

Steele - 6 - thought his distribution was poor (by his standards) . Bart could have lumped it long, just as well as Steele did,
Dunk - 6 - Possibly a little harsh, but his standards are so high, I tend to under-mark him.
Igor - 6 - Good in patches but felt like our weaker link in defence. Made some important interventions though.
JPvH - 7 - Best of teh centrebacks - thank God we will still have him for West Ham.
Hinsh - 8 - Immense. was so relieved o see him at RB. Smashed in his goal, giving the keeper little chance
Gilmour - 8 - Dominant, getting better all the time.
Gross - 7 - Decent as always, but he looks tired. a few uncharacteristically loose passes
Milner - 8 - Furious to see him start, but oh my god! He was incredible.
Buononotte - 7 -Really adapting to the division now. Pressed well and won the ball back multiple times. Hope the injury is not severe
Welbeck - 8 - Should have had a goal - but absolutely superb. He is making the difference to our attacking threat.
Joao Pedro - 8 - All over the pitch, he was superb. De Zerbi criticized him earlier in the season for not doing enough in defence. He Listened - MotM

Subs -
Moder - 6 - precious minutes, good to see him back
Estupinan - 7 - Understandably off the pace at first, but what a f***ing hit that was
Baleba - 6 - Important minutes again - Powerful, will be a force to reckon with, but probably not this season.
Ferguson - 6 - Won an obvious penalty but didn't do too much else. Can (and will) learn a lot from Welbeck.
Lallana - N/A
